Labour on training for shop stewards and advice offices

Department of Labour and CCMA train shop stewards

21 June 2007

The Department of Labour in Cape Town in conjunction with the Commission for
Conciliation Mediation and Arbitration (CCMA) are this week conducting training
for shop stewards and advice offices with specific attention to the Labour
Relations and Basic Conditions of Employment Act. The training started on
Tuesday and will end today, Thursday. The purpose of the training is to empower
and assist shop stewards at floor level with interpretation and understanding
of the legislation in order for them to help fellow workers to resolve work
place disputes effectively.

Labour Spokesperson Zolisa Sigabi said, "It is the department's view that
well informed shop stewards will reduce the cases received both at Labour
Centres and CCMA offices drastically as disputes will be resolved competently
at the work place". A list of the training schedule for the year is obtainable
from the CCMA offices in 78 Darling Street, Cape Town.
